Anupong warns Chon Buri residents over funeral protest


Across the country, 20 million people laid funeral flowers as last tributes to the much-beloved monarch last Thursday – the day of the Royal Cremation – with mourners forming long lines for hours to pay tribute. However, in Chon Buri people became so upset that they staged a protest against Chon Buri Governor Pakathorn Tianchai this week. “Think carefully before you make a scene over this issue,” Anupong said. “Our probe also shows that the governor came to the venue early, not late like people suggested,” Anupong said. However, he declined to further comment on allegations that the Chon Buri governor should have facilitated the huge crowds more efficiently.
